T8831: smoketests: irregular PermissionError caused by systemctl stop
Failures appear during PPPoEIf.remove() -> flush_addrs() -> set_dhcpv6(False),
where disable uses self._cmd(f'systemctl stop ...'), which raises on any
non-zero exit code of cmd().
PermissionError: [Errno 1] is misleading: cmd() raises OSError(exit_code,
feedback); exit code 1 maps to PermissionError in Python 3, so logs point at
"permissions" while the real signal is systemctl stop returned 1 (job failure,
timeout, restart contention with Restart=always on dhcp6c@.service.
Add a small systemd teardown helper stop_systemd_unit() validating the return
codes from the "systemctl stop" calls.
